Ferro-actinolite-Tremolite Series

A solid-solution series between two end-member minerals
This page is currently not sponsored. Click here to sponsor this page.
Hide all sections | Show all sections

About Ferro-actinolite-Tremolite SeriesHide

Crystal System:
Monoclinic
Series Formula:
◻Ca2Fe52+(Si8O22)(OH)2 to ◻Ca2Mg5(Si8O22)(OH)2
A series between Ferro-actinolite and Tremolite

This series includes the "intermediate" member actinolite.
